Drag and drop doesn't work from Netscape 7.2

Firefox 3 does not accept drag and drop URL's from Netscape 7.2. If u drag a URL from the location or a link in Netscape 7.2 onto Firefox's window, nothing happens. This does work from Netscape 4.79 and Internet Explorer and Firefox itself. This functionality was present in Firefox 2 and worked with no issues.
The URL can be dropped onto Firefox's location bar however. This functions according to the highlight-copy-drag-paste text idiom.
Reproducible: Always
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Drag any URL onto Firefox's window from Netscape 7.2.
Actual Results:
Nothing
Expected Results:
Firefox should go to the dropped URL.
